Mt SAC Athletes to be Honored for Championship Basketball Runs

The mens and womens teams have been invited to the April 2 meeting of the Los Angeles County Board of Supervisors meeting where they will be honored.

Mount San Antonio College men’s and women’s basketball squads will be honored by Los Angeles County Board of Supervisors for what some are calling inspiring championship wins.

Both teams earned their respective California Community College Athletic Association, or CCCAA, basketball championships on March 17. Both are scheduled to be honored during the April 2 meeting of the Los Angeles County Board of Supervisors.

According to a Mountie Athletics article by writer Fred Baer, Mt. SAC's lady Mounties went on a 16-0 run to defeat Mount San Jacinto College, 54-41, after trailing 40-38.

It was a close game that was tied eight times, according to the report.

The all-tournament team is:

  • Whitney Edens, Santa Rosa
  • Madison Parrish, Fresno
  • Destiny Melton, Mt. San Jacinto
  • Tina Fantroy, Mt. San Jacinto
  • Shawlina Segovia, Mt. San Antonio
  • Ashley Burchfield, Mt. San Antonio
  • Ashley Carter, Mt. San Antonio (MVP)

The men’s basketball squad’s win was called historic in a separate article written by Baer as Mt. San Antonio College tallied the highest score in CCCAA Men's Basketball Championship history.

The Mounties defeated Chaffey College, in Rancho Cucamonga, 102-88, at the Cosumnes River College Community and Athletic Center in Sacramento.

Mt. SAC led by as many 23 points - with a score of 58-35 - with 15:22 left in the game, Baer wrote. The Panthers crept to within eight points at 83-75 with 3:35 left on the clock but a seven-point run by the Mounties then led to the victory, , according to Baers wrote.

All-tournament team is:

  • Quincy Smith, CCSF
  • Marcus Green, Merritt
  • Ryan Nitz, Chaffey
  • Justin Long, Chaffey
  • Corey Allen, Mt. SAC
  • Garret Nevels, Mt. SAC (MVP)
